In a new appearance in the podcast, Gwyneth Paltrow sets foot on the persistent rumors of a quarrel with Meghan Markle – who, like Paltrow, has created a lifestyle (Paltrow’s, of course, is Goop; Meghan’s is still).
Although Paltrow and the Duchess of Sussex have already crushed the rumors of beef in a video that Paltrow published on Instagram, Paltrow explained the problem while speaking with the sisters Erin Foster and Sara Foster in their program The first podcast in the world with Erin & Sara Foster, which was released on April 24.

“Do you know what I will not be at this stage of my life?” Paltrow said after asking if rumors about conflicts between her and Meghan were true. “I will not be a pawn in a triangulation of the quarrel of women for your fucking clickbait.”
“Leave us outside,” she continued. “Don’t do that. I won’t defend that.”
Echoing the comments she had said about Wishing Meghan in the lifestyle space – where Paltrow also succeeded since the creation of Goop in 2008 – she said yesterday: “Once again, I only wish Meghan nothing other than the best. Like, it’s so great what she does. I am proud of her.”
“Each woman deserves to go in everything he wants to do,” she added.

After a cover story on March 18 to VanityLast month, Paltrow – with a surprise cameo from Meghan – turned to Instagram to officially approach rumors that the neighbors of Montecito disagreed. On March 25, Paltrow participated in a fan Q & R on its Instagram history, and a fan asked if Paltrow was aware of the “social media of Meghan Markle Beef says you both have”. To this, Paltrow said: “I really don’t understand that at all”, before the camera goes to Meghan sitting in a dining pie – a reference to Paltrow Vanity Interview where she suggested that she could bring a pie to her neighbors Meghan and Prince Harry.
“Do you understand that?” Paltrow asked Meghan, who brought her shoulders as if he did not know any aforementioned drama.

“(When) there is noise on certain women in culture, I always have a strong instinct to defend them,” said Paltrow VanityAdding that she “was raised to see other women like friends, not enemies”.
“I think there is always more than enough to go around,” she said. “Everyone deserves an attempt at everything they want to try.”
